@@ -0,0 +1,298 @@
"""Native activation transport over direct gRPC or the existing relay RPC.
This is deliberately a *seam adapter*, not a new relay protocol. Direct
peers use one generated ``ShardRuntime.Session`` bidi stream for the lifetime
of a Route Session. A relayed peer uses the relay's existing HTTP-shaped
binary-body contract: each body is exactly a serialized ``SessionRequest`` or
``SessionResponse``. The relay only routes those bytes and restores its own
request id; it does not deserialize a native frame.
The correlation headers are duplicated outside the opaque frame solely for
the existing tracker/relay observability and billing path. The authoritative
work, route, epoch, deadline, and cancellation information remains in the
versioned protobuf frame and is validated before it is sent.
"""
